Tottenham Hotspur Beat Arsenal To England's Top Young Talent Alli, Wenger Reveals
Published: April 29, 2017
Arsenal manager Arsene Wenger has revealed that the club scouted Dele Alli several times before he transferred to Tottenham Hotspur in 2015.
Ahead of the Gunners visit to White Hart Lane on Sunday, the Frenchman has heaped praise onto the Tottenham Hotspur number 20, describing him as a goalscoring midfielder.
“He played for MK, down the road here. You have to say he’s done extremely well, ” Wenger told the national press.
“He works very well, he’s a complete player and very dangerous. He scores goals – absolutely marvellous at his age.”
Wenger added : “They’ve done well to buy him and give him a chance, they deserve credit for that.
“We watched him a few times I’m sure because we watched MK a lot.”
Dele Alli was also the subject of interest from Liverpool but the Reds chiefs pulled the plug on the deal because he was too expensive for a teenager.
